K-Means Clustering and Predictive Dependence of Personality Traits in Dark Triad Model

Abstract
Machiavellianism, Narcissism and Psychopathy are the three traits expounded by the Dark Triad Model of Personality. These building blocks of personality cover a large and interconnected spectrum of personality. The use of Machine Learning can help in analysing largesized databases to draw meaningful comparisons. In this paper, we have used K-Means Clustering to investigate dark personality clustering in a very large database comprising 18192 respondents. The data was normalised and then subjected to unsupervised machine learning to classify it into four separate clusters. The data was clustered evenly among the four clusters. To evaluate the interdependence of the personality traits intraclass (0.537) and Pearson's correlations were computed. Two of the SD3 traits were used to regress on the third and the process was used for all of them alternatively. Pearson's correlation between Machiavellianism and Psychopathy was highest at 0.721 and the same was corroborated by the regression equations between the two traits. Narcissism showed equal correlations with Machiavellianism (0.475) and Psychopathy (0.453). Regression equation revealed that Machiavellianism was most significantly affected by Psychopathy and vice versa. Regression results for Machiavellianism and Psychopathy indicated fair predictive capabilities with R2 values of 0.547 and 0.535 respectively
